Literature summary for 2.1.1.45 extracted from

  • Bijnsdorp, I.V.; Comijn, E.M.; Padron, J.M.; Gmeiner, W.H.; Peters, G.J.
    Mechanisms of action of FdUMP[10]: metabolite activation and thymidylate synthase inhibition (2007), Oncol. Rep., 18, 287-291.

Inhibitors

Inhibitors Comment Organism Structure
5-fluoro-2'-deoxyuridine comparison with inhibitory effect of FdUMP[10] and 5-fluorouraci Mus musculus
5-Fluoro-2-deoxyuridine FUdR Mus musculus
5-fluoro-dUMP
-
Mus musculus
5-fluoro-dUMP[10] a 10-mer of 5-fluoro-dUMP, a suicide inhibitor of thymidylate synthase, designed to bypass resistance to 5-fluorouracil, acts as a pro-drug of 5-fluoro-dUMP Mus musculus
5-fluorouracil comparison with inhibitory effect of FdUMP[10] and 5-fluoro-2'-deoxyuridine Mus musculus
FdUMP[10] multimer of 5-fluoro-2'-deoxyuridine 5'-monophosphate, inhibits cell growth with greater potency than 5-fluorouracil and 5-fluoro-2'-deoxyuridine Mus musculus
GW1843U89 direct folate-based inhibitor Mus musculus
additional information combination of leucovorin and 5-fluorouracil 5FU-LV, IC50 0.00016 (FM3A/0 cell) Mus musculus
nolatrexed
-
Mus musculus
pemetrexed direct folate-based inhibitor; inhibitory to cell growth even in cell lacking thymidylate synthase activity Mus musculus
raltitrexed direct folate-based inhibitor Mus musculus
